Hello, I.m a software engineer in Samjin,  Korea and developing some BLE nodes with CSR1010.
 
I read some documents (CSR10xx Production Line CS-226266-DC-2.pdf) about CSR10xx Gang Programmer.
 
Then I have a couple of questions, can I buy this gang programmer from CSR or
 
CSR only provides guidelines for making the gang programmer?
 
If I use USB hub and several CNS10020V2A interface boards to build a multiple programming system,
 
should I make a PC application for it?

Hi Joowon,

 

There is an equivalent USB-SPI adapter (DK-USB-SPI-10225-1A-ND) to the CNS10020v2 that is much cheaper and does the same equivalent function.  Check www.digikey.com and search for the part number shown above.

 

Each of these USB devices, when connected to a PC will have its own unique identifier, so you can access each individually when there is more than 1 device connected to the PC.
